"The product helps users stay on top of gaining insight into the active directory, permissions and security sets, and user group policy changes."
"It is easy to identify and collect information from all of the nodes on the network."
"The technical support is good."
"Dell Foglight does analyze and optimize your virtual infrastructure. It definitely reduces operational cost."
"Real time database monitoring and alerting are valuable."
"Infrastructure Monitoring and End User Monitoring are the product’s most valuable features to me."
"Capacity on database and file servers. I found the algorithms to forecast growth and concerns particularly intuitive."
"At a glance I can easily see what is going on with all of my VMware environments, including top consumers of resources."
"It provides a history of the activities on our SQL servers."
"The most valuable feature is drill-down monitoring, which shows us from one interface the transaction chain from the front end to back end."
"Having standard monitoring features and a central repository saves us a lot of time and reduces risk of incidents."
"The Wi-Fi side needs improvement."
"We would like to have support for integration with ServiceDesk."
"The product could use more intelligence, automation and general availability of product information."
"The ManageEngine features could improve to show graphs of the traffic and network utility."
"I want to see a new interface that contains HTML5 features. The current version of Foglight (on-premise edition) is so fusty in comparison with leaders of Gartner APM Quadrant - i.e. Appdynamics, NewRelic, Dynatrace."
"We are running a Webmethods stack (Software AG) and Foglight is unable to instrument. We are in a POC with Dynatrace and it was able to instrument with little effort."
"I would perhaps like to see more SSMS connections."
"The “cartridge” concept for every little thing is a bit of a bother to implement."
"The version compatibility needs work."
"They need to improve the stability of FxM and FxV."
"It needs a more intuitive way to create and implement custom "Cartridges" to be deployed through out a Federated environment."
"I think installation and setup needs little more improvement especially when you are installing with external database."
